A contemporary take on the classic Sorel boot, the Joan of Arctic uses a wonderful mix of feature and fashion. Fully water resistant with a suede upper and joint securing, it's a tough option for day-to-day wear.
Even more, the heavy and confusing style really feels dated and can be troublesome on longer strolls. To be clear, the waterproofing is exceptional, and the Joan of Arctic will absolutely do the trick in moderate conditions, however we prefer the more versatile options above.

No person does traditional natural leather boots fairly like Keen, and their Greta combines that traditional styling with down-like quilting at the collar that's reminiscent of a puffy coat. Place just, this boot is an actual reward both in regards to appearances and well-rounded comfort and efficiency with affordable specs to back it up.
The fit is also very personalized for logging trail gas mileage, while the cushioned collar and tongue look the part for casual wear. Eager makes some of our favorite hiking boots on the market, and the Greta complies with suit in an extremely practical winter-ready construct.
The Greta also wins out as a crossover option for both route and around-town use, while the Oboz leans more towards the efficiency end of the spectrum. Other alternatives in the Greta collection are equally well constructed, consisting of the extra safety Greta Tall (9 in.) that belows in felt spots at the collar and check over here Greta Chelsea that incorporates chic city styling with the very same capable outsole (it's a good efficiency upgrade from the Blundstone over).

Down booties have their location for executing camp jobs and quick trips from the tent yet do not have versatility for using around town or strolling longer ranges. Danner has actually created an appealing service in their Cloud Cap Boots, which combine a down bootie-like top with sturdy and hardwearing suede around the forefoot and heel.
Integrated with a 2-layer water resistant membrane layer and generous 400-gram PrimaLoft insulation, the Cloud Cap stands out as a cozy and sturdy alternative with a spirited look. The Cloud Cap has actually turned into one of our tester's go-to boots. his response The straightforward drawstring closure makes it unbelievably very easy to tackle and off (wonderful for quick journeys to the garage or mailbox), but the trade-off is much less modification and a sloppier feeling.
Our listing wouldn't be complete without one more winterized treking boot from the genuine Danner. Here, the Hill 600 boot obtains a frozen upgrade, with 200-gram PrimaLoft insulation, a Vibram Arctic Grasp single, and a side zipper along the instep for less complicated on and off (though if tied up tight, opening up the zipper usually isn't adequate to obtain the boot off without some unknoting).
